spyboy1 Posted November 20, 2003 Share Posted November 20, 2003 On a mac, if you hit shift/command(apple) and the number 4, you will get a 'cross hairs' on your monitor. Then click and drag the area you want to capture and it will 'take a photo' of the area you have selected and save it to your hard drive. You can then take that image capture and drag it to your photoshop or illustrator icon to open the image in those programs.Simply clicking on the icon of the picture will open it in simple text or picture viewer and doesn't allow you to work with it.Shift/command(apple) and the number 3 will take a picture of your entire screen and all the clutter on it.JeffB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
